In order to provide alternative financing support to micro, small, and medium-sized enterprises (mSMEs), the Labour Fund (Tamkeen) has signed a partnership agreement with Safaghat, a pioneering crowdfunding investment platform licensed by the Central Bank of Bahrain. By addressing Bahraini enterprises' unique financial needs, this collaboration aims to foster growth and economic impact in the entrepreneurship ecosystem and by extension, sustainably grow Bahrain.
Using a portion of the profits, Tamkeen will provide financing loans to eligible Bahraini mSMEs, helping them to raise funds locally and internationally. A Sharia-compliant crowdfunding platform will facilitate the distribution of these funds.

Specifically tailored to tech businesses and those heavily reliant on intangible assets, the programme offers debt-based financing. As well as providing quick access to capital and requiring minimal collateral, it ensures that even small businesses can take advantage of it. In addition, the program is open to innovative and high-potential mSMEs operating for less than three years. Safaghat's website, safaghat.com, is the place where interested companies can apply.
